Wave 50 will not lower

Hello
I have big problem. Wave 50-118 will not lower sometimes. The platform locks at different heights.
I have already exchanged:
-solenoid valve
-velocity fuse

I checked connections and buttons. Everything is ok :(

The only hint is that it always happens at low battery voltage.
Does anyone know what is the lowest coil voltage on the solenoid which the solenoid valve will open ?

If you can still manually lower the platform after it stops, then the cylinder is ok. Check resistance through the lowering switch. If there is 1 ohm or more, that will give you lower-than-battery volts causing the coil not to work. Pretty sure under 20v....it will not always work

Brothers Adolf ("Adi") and Rudolf ("Rudi") Dassler split their shoe company after WWII due to a bitter feud, and established the rival companies of Adidas and Puma. Their personal animosity and business rivalry divided their German hometown Herzogenaurach. The town became known as "the town of bent necks" due to the intense loyalty to each brand.
